It’s not just the models and ensembles coming down the catwalk that are being judged, the Fashion PR companies behind New York Fashion Week’s runway shows receive their fair share of scrutiny. With New York Fashion Week at a close, enjoy two examples of the best and the worst Fashion PR hot from the online fashion presses.
Via New York Magazine, Fugly girls take aim at People’s Revolution for being more concerned with favors to friends than frenzied media waiting to get in at the Heatherette show.
PFSK’s Orli Sharaby gives Mao PR a gold star for embodying the three Fashion PR must-haves:
1. Deliver a Great Product
2. Extend Your Brand
3. Be Nice
